• КРАСНАЯ ЦЕНА чему coll[NP; sing only; usu. subj or subj-compl with быть (subj: a noun denoting a specified amount of money); fixed WO]=====⇒ the most s.o. thinks that sth. is worth, the highest price that s.o. would be willing to pay for sth.:- ten rubles is the top < the best> price (that s.o. would offer) for X;- s.o. would pay ten rubles tops for X;- the most s.o. would pay for X is ten rubles.♦ "Я полагаю с своей стороны...: по восьми гривен за душу, это самая красная цена!" (Гоголь 3). "I, for my part, would offer eighty kopecks per soul....This is the top price" (3c).Большой русско-английский фразеологический словарь > красная цена

3 Ipis wa inkara
syn.: Piski to count, to count up считать, подсчитывать Si-ne One Один. Tu Two Два. Re Three Три. I-ne Four Четыре. Asik-ne Five Пять. I-wan Six Шесть. Ara-wan Seven Семь. Tup-e-san Eight Восемь. Si-ne-p-e-san Nine Девять. Wan Ten Десять. Hot-ne Twenty Двадцать. Wan e hot-ne Thirty Тридцать. Tu hot-ne Forty Сорок. Wan e re hot-ne Fifty Пятьдесят. Tu ikasma wan e re hot-ne Fifty two Пятьдесят два. Wan e i-ne hot-ne Seventy Семьдесят. I-ne hot-ne Eighty Восемьдесят. Wan e asik-ne hot-ne Ninety Девяносто. Asik-ne hot-ne Hundred Сто.
